In the field of assisted reproductive technology, numerous techniques and advancements have been made to enhance the success rates of In-vitro Fertilization (IVF). One such development is the utilization of embryo glue, a specialized solution used during embryo transfer procedures. In this blog post, we will delve into the details of embryo glue, its composition, benefits and the process of using it during IVF.

A. Understanding Embryo Glue

Embryo glue, also known as the embryo transfer medium, is a specially formulated solution designed to improve the embryo's chances of implantation during IVF. It serves as a temporary adhesive and provides a nurturing environment for the embryo.

C. Benefits of Using Embryo Glue

The application of embryo glue during IVF procedures offers several potential advantages, including:

  • Enhanced embryo-endometrium interaction: The adhesive properties of the glue facilitate better attachment of the embryo to the uterine lining, increasing the chances of successful implantation.
  • Reduced embryo displacement: Embryo glue helps keep the embryo in place, minimizing the risk of its displacement during and after transfer.
  • Improved implantation rates: Studies have suggested that the use of embryo glue may lead to higher implantation rates and improved pregnancy outcomes.
  • Potential for frozen embryo transfers (FET): Embryo glue can also be used during FET cycles to enhance the implantation of thawed embryos.

D. The Process of Using Embryo Glue

The application of embryo glue is typically incorporated into the embryo transfer procedure. Here's a step-by-step overview:

  • Selection of the embryo: The embryologist selects the most viable embryo(s) based on specific criteria, such as morphology and developmental stage.
  • Preparation of the catheter: The embryo glue solution is drawn into the embryo transfer catheter.
  • Loading the embryo: The selected embryo(s) are carefully loaded into the catheter containing the embryo glue.
  • Transfer procedure: The physician guides the catheter through the cervix into the uterus, placing the embryo(s) at the desired location within the uterine cavity.
  • Confirmation and removal: The catheter is checked to ensure successful embryo transfer, and then gently removed.
  • Post-transfer care: After the procedure, the patient is typically advised to rest for a short period before resuming normal activities.

Conclusion

Embryo glue is an innovative tool used during IVF procedures to improve embryo implantation rates. By creating an environment that mimics the natural conditions of the uterus, embryo glue offers potential benefits such as enhanced embryo-endometrium interaction, reduced embryo displacement and improved implantation rates. As the field of assisted reproductive technology continues to advance, embryo glue represents a promising development that can contribute to increased success rates in fertility treatments.

What is the principle of embryo glue?

The principle of embryo glue is to create an optimal environment that mimics the natural conditions of the uterus for embryo implantation during IVF. It serves as a temporary adhesive and provides a nurturing environment for the embryo. The adhesive properties facilitate better attachment of the embryo to the uterine lining, while its composition supports embryo development and promotes successful implantation by enhancing embryo-endometrium interaction.

Does embryo glue actually work?

Yes, studies suggest that embryo glue works to improve IVF outcomes. The use of embryo glue may lead to higher implantation rates and better chances of getting pregnant. Its benefits include enhanced embryo-endometrium interaction through its adhesive properties, reduced embryo displacement by keeping the embryo in place and improved implantation rates.

What is embryo glue used for?

Embryo glue, also known as embryo transfer medium, is used during IVF embryo transfer procedures to improve the embryo's chances of implantation. It serves as a temporary adhesive and provides a nurturing environment for the embryo. The glue is used to enhance embryo-endometrium interaction, reduce embryo displacement during and after transfer and improve implantation rates. It can be used during both fresh embryo transfers and FET cycles to enhance the implantation of thawed embryos.

Can embryo glue harm the embryo?

Embryo glue is generally considered safe and does not harm embryos when used properly during IVF procedures. It is specifically formulated to mimic natural uterine conditions and support embryo development. The solution undergoes rigorous testing and quality control. However, as with any medical intervention, it should only be used under proper clinical supervision. Some fertility specialists may recommend it based on individual circumstances. Always discuss potential benefits and any concerns with your fertility doctor to make informed decisions about your treatment.
